The Deputy had a printed sheet of questions that he asked and made notes on. I am sure this is part of the standard procedure.
My Deputy was very helpful and encouraging. I found out later from the Lieutenant that he was only briefly on loan to the CCW process.
With some stable staff and others moving in and out, a prescribed process with standardized questions structures the interview, allows it to collect new information, clarify responses from the application, provides a face to face assessment of the applicant and makes the data collection part of the interview comparable to each applicant no matter who conducts the interview.
The LASD could not afford an unstructured interview that heavily depended upon the conducting Deputy. There’s too much at stake for the LASD and those issued.4/19/21 applied, 8/31 Whittier interview.
